Abstract

본 발명은 현악기의 구조를 이용한 자연 공명 스피커에 관한 것으로 콘트라 베이스, 첼로, 바이올린, 통키타등의 현악기 구조물에서 발견되는 음향 주파수 특성이 우수하고 뛰어난 입체감을 나타내는 현악기 공명 현상을 이용하여 고전음악 재생에 우수한 특성을 발휘하는 스피커이다.
이러한 본 발명은 옆면의 상부와 하부가 볼록한 곡면구조를 갖고 좌, 우측 옆면간부는 오목한 곡면구조를 가지면 앞판과 뒷판은 모두 바깥쪽으로 구면과 유사한 볼록한 모양을 갖고 옆면의 모목한 위치근방의 앞판에 1개 이상의 구멍을 갖는 몸체를 구비하며 상기 앞판 구멍사이에 전기음성신호를 기계음성진동으로 변환시키는 진동 유니트의 진동자를 몸체에 직접 결합시킴으로써 이루어 진다.

Claims (6)

  1. 앞면의 상부와 하부가 볼록한 곡면구조를 갖고, 좌,우측 옆면중간부는 오목한 곡면구조를 가지며 앞판과 뒷판은 모두 바깥쪽으로 구면과 유사한 볼록한 모양을 갖고 옆면의 오목한 위치근방의 앞판에 1개 이상의 공명흠을 갖는 몸체를 구비하며 상기 앞판 공명흠 사이에 전기음성신호를 기계음성진동으로 변환시키는 진동 유니트의 진동자를 몸체에 직접 결합시켜 이루어지는 것을 특징으로 하는 자연 공명 스피커.
  2. 제1항에 있어서, 진동 유니트는 나팔관 모양을 갖고 나팔관형 몸체 안쪽의 끝부분에 이어지는 같은 몸체로 이루어지는 일정길이의 원통형관에 솔레노이드 코일이 수차례 감겨서 강한 접착으로 이루어지고 몸체에 결합되는 진동자와, 상기 솔레오이드 코일의 안쪽과 바깥쪽에 각각 두자극이 위치하는 형태로 자장이 걸리는 구조의 자석 구조물로 이루어지고 상기 진동자와 자석 구조물은 기계적으로 분리되는 것을 특징으로 하는 자연 공명 스피커.
  3. 제2항에 있어서, 자석 구조물은 몸체 내부에 고정되는 고정대에 결합되고 상기 몸체와 고정대 사이, 자석 구조물과 고정대 사이에는 방진재를 삽입시켜 음향진동 전달을 방지하는 자연 공명 스피커.
  4. 제1항에 있어서, 진동자 대신에 기존의 콘지방식 등의 앞뒤로 음의 방사가 가능한 유니트를 부착시킨 것을 특징으로 하는 자연 공명 스피커.
  5. 제1항에 있어서, 저음용 유니트와 고음용 유니트를 분리하여 장치하기 위해 저음용 대형 몸체의 앞판 임의의 위치에 동일한 구조의 고음용 소형 몸체가 결합된 형태를 가질때 고음용 몸체 앞면 또는 뒷면이 저음용 몸체 앞면과 함께 공유하는 형태를 갖거나 또는 고음용 몸체 옆면의 모양을 따라 저음용 몸체 앞면이 절단된 후 그 속으로 고음용 몸체의 옆면이 일정위치까지 삽입되어 서로 부착된 형태를 갖는 것을 특징으로 하는 자연 공명 스피커.
  6. 제1항 또는 제2항에 있어서, 진동자는 몸체를 구성하는 재질과 동일한 나무 또는 합성수지로 이루어지는 것을 특징으로 하는 자연 공명 스피커.
